LINUX.ORG.RU

История изменений

Исправление den73, (текущая версия) :

Ну что, ты меня спас, мил человек! Убрал я puts при вставке каждого актора (а puts в моём случае вызвает update, т.к. это форк tkcon) и стало быстрее раз в 20. Не всё ещё ясно, но куда копать - понял.

string cat - это да, просто сложение строк, появилось в 8.6. Мне так привычнее, у меня мозг не заточен под tcl. Если б знал, что оно так недавно появилось, не стал бы применять.

Зачем "::cty::CheckIdentifierOk $Name" с таким regexp? Ну, о "::" позаботился, и порядок.

Это нужно точно понимать, как не попасть в кавычечный ад. А я пока далёк от этого.

«foreach {x y z} $Center {}» - начиная с 8.5 есть lassign.

Спасибо, буду знать!

Исходная версия den73, :

Ну что, ты меня спас, мил человек! Убрал я puts при вставке каждого актора (а puts в моём случае вызвает update, т.к. это форк tkcon) и стало быстрее раз в 20. Не всё ещё ясно, но куда копать - понял.

string cat - это да, просто сложение строк, появилось в 8.6. Мне так привычнее, у меня мозг не заточен под tcl. Если б знал, что оно так недавно появилось, не стал бы применять.

Зачем "::cty::CheckIdentifierOk $Name" с таким regexp? Ну, о "::" позаботился, и порядок.

Это нужно точно понимать, как не попасть в кавычечный ад. А я пока далёк от этого.

«foreach {x y z} $Center {}» - начиная с 8.5 есть lassign.

Спасибо, буду знать!